The Government of Peru, through the Foreign Affairs Ministry, has expressed its concern and condemnation of the ballistic missile launches carried out by the Democratic People's Republic of Korea on September 25, 28, and 29, which aggravate tensions on the Korean peninsula.

"Such actions constitute a serious threat to international peace and security, as well as violate international law and the specific mandates established by the United Nations Security Council," the government agency indicated in a statement on Friday evening.

Within this framework, Peru reaffirms its commitment to general and complete nuclear disarmament —under strict and effective international control. 

It also reiterates that the peaceful path is the best way to resolve conflicts.
